Surgery Features

Under local anesthesia, a catheter measuring 1mm (including laser fiber) is placed in the subcutaneous fat layer. Through the laser light energy, the fat cell membranes are dissolved, and the dissolved fat will be excreted through the body’s metabolism, thereby achieving the effect of partial body sculpting.

WHO NEED Laser-Assisted Lipectomy

Laser-Assisted Lipectomy has sound therapeutic effects for localized fat, such as double chin, baby fat, flabby arms, accessory breast, and fat in thighs and knees.

Surgical Approach

Laser-Assisted Lipectomy Under local anesthesia, a catheter 1mm in size (including laser fibers) entered the subcutaneous fat layer through a fine probe. Within a short period of time, the high-energy laser was used to rapidly fire laser light energy and dissolve the fat cell membranes. The dissolved fat is then eliminated through the body’s metabolism, thereby achieving local sculpting results. The dissolved fat can be eliminated from the body through the body’s metabolism and lymphatic circulation. Body sculpting and firming results can be achieved after 1~3 months. The fat dissolution technology not only requires no long-term postoperative massage and reduces pain and discomfort, but also greatly shortens the “corsage wearing” time.

Precautions

1.The laser lipolysis result lasts about one to three months on average, depending on the constitution and metabolism speed of individuals, the treatment size and site, and the amount of fat dissolved. For faster results, drink plenty of liquids, switch to a light diet, and exercise.

 

2.Apply cold press as frequently as possible within 48 hours after laser lipolysis to improve bruising and swelling. Apply hot press and massage after 48 hours. A corsage should be worn for 24 hours on the first day and at least 12 hours afterwards. The corsage should be worn for one month.

Q&A

Q:What is laser lipolysis?

A:Laser lipolysis refers the use of laser heat to destroy subcutaneous fat cells. Then, fat is brought back to the liver through the blood and lymphatic circulation for excretion outside the body through metabolism, thereby achieving the sculpting goal.


Q:Can laser lipolysis help lose weight?

A:Similar to liposuction, laser lipolysis can reduced the amount of fat. This surgery is for sculpting, rather than losing weight.


Q:Is laser lipolysis applicable for the abdomen, thighs and other sites with large amounts of fat?

A:Laser lipolysis alone dissolves large amounts of fat that cannot be metabolized. It is suitable only for sites that have a small amount of fat. For sites with large amounts of fat, such as the abdomen, waist, inner and outer thighs, and below buttocks, fat drainage is needed. Otherwise, the fat that cannot be metabolized will form hardened masses and even result in unevenness.


Q:Is the laser lipolysis process painful? Is there postoperative pain?

A:Only slight pain s felt when anesthesia is injected. Subsequent laser and drainage are not painful. However, for those that are extremely nervous or have low tolerance to pain, sedatives may be used to reduce the pain. Bruising pain will only be felt during the evening after the surgery or the next day. The pain normally subsides within two weeks. Painkillers prescribed by the surgeon are available if needed.


Q:Can I still undergo laser lipolysis since I had undergone liposuction before?

A:Yes, you can. Laser lipolysis can continue to dissolve the remaining fat. In addition, the optical heat effect of laser will firm up and smooth sagging skin caused by liposuction.
